Abstract
It is proved that the radially symmetric solutions of the repulsive Euler-Poisson equations with a non-zero background, corresponding to cold plasma oscillations blow up in many spatial dimensions except for for almost all initial data. The initial data, for which the solution may not blow up, correspond to simple waves. Moreover, if a solution is globally smooth in time, then it is either affine or tends to affine as .
